Your Team, Your Impact

As a Financial Analyst at Marvell, you'll work closely with the business unit you support to provide meaningful data analysis. Your team has a certain budget for resources and you'll help them decide how to use that budget most effectively. Should we get more new lab equipment or hire another team member? Are we on track with the forecast? Will this new product deliver a positive return on investment given its costs? You're the one providing the analysis to help your team decide.

What You Can Expect

Financial Analysis

  • Dive deep into financial data, performance metrics, and key performance indicators (KPIs) to uncover trends and insights that will drive our success

  • Craft and present financial reports that tell a compelling story, including mon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ements, along with variance analyses

Budgeting and Forecasting

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to shape our annual budgeting process

  • Develop and manage financial models that empower us to forecast accurately and perform scenario analysis on Opex, Capex, and Headcount

  • Keep a watchful eye on budget vs. actual performance, providing strategic recommendations for adjustments

Cost Analysis

  • Be part of our drive to optimize manufacturing and operational expenses through detailed cost analysis

  • Evaluate product costs, pricing strategies, and profitability to ensure our competitive edge

Project ROI

  • Utilize your financial acumen and Excel skills to develop robust models that calculate key performance indicators such as payback, NPV, IRR, and ROI, enabling comprehensive evaluation of project feasibility and long-term value

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to gather and validate critical inputs-including R&D expenditures and detailed cost modeling data-to ensure accuracy and reliability in your financial assessments

Ad Hoc Analysis

  • Dive into exciting ad hoc financial analysis projects and deliver insights that will shape our strategic direction
